But who is the author, you ask? Her name is Fabienne Carat, and between you and me, this lady is a real hard worker and an artist with many skills in her arsenal! She dances, cooks, draws, cuts hair, writes, decorates, acts on stage, and also acts behind a television camera. But yes, her lovely face must seem familiar: Fabienne plays the role of Samia Nassri in the series “Plus belle la vie.” And today, we present her to you as a singer.
This month, Fabienne presents her first album “Darkpink,” which was “created” in Beausoleil with her composer, Maurice Ouazana. “It’s a very colorful album! “Darkpink” is the meeting of two worlds: childhood and adulthood. “Pink” represents childhood, sweetness, candies. “Dark” is the adult world with its darkness and the difficulties we encounter. “Darkpink” symbolizes the taming and reconciliation of these two worlds. In fact, we discover the confrontation of these two universes at the time of adolescence,” explains Fabienne Carat.
In her first album, Fabienne offers you eleven cheerful and rhythmic tracks, eight of which were written by her hand. It includes love stories: betrayal, romantic disappointment, stifled passion, happiness, friendship … and also cigarettes: “I’m not a smoker, but I suffered from not starting because smoking facilitates integration and gives presence when you’re young. It’s not easy to start smoking, but it’s even harder to quit. Better not start! I’m very sensitive to this subject, and I spoke about it like a former smoker,” explains Fabienne. “In this album, I also speak about my dad. I send him a message of love. In these songs, there are many lived inspirations transcribed poetically,” she continues.
Besides the musical universe, “Darkpink” is a concept where the main protagonist is “Darkpink,” obviously! “I imagined a Darkpink manga. She is very beautiful. It’s my caricature in manga form, but better! She is sweet, strong, fragile, unattainable, and inaccessible. She is dark and pink,” describes Fabienne. A manga character! “More later!” she continues.
Musical universe and also? “Olfactory. I am passionate about perfume. I’ve been mixing my perfumes for over fifteen years. I never found a perfume that suits me. Every morning, I mix five or six perfumes. It becomes an anxiety over time. So, the perfume I created in Grasse, it’s me. The fragrance traces the Darkpink universe. It is fruity, caramelized, warm, sweet, and at the same time, it has patchouli notes that reflect the strong intensity present in this universe. It resembles me. I am proud of it. And ironically, it suits men very well! Although the packaging is very feminine, this perfume is for everyone,” presents Fabienne Carat.
